Official abstract text for this publication.
The present invention relates to a low-temperature additive for fuel oils having a sulfur content of less than 50 ppm, comprising i) at least one oil-soluble amide-ammonium salt of a polycarboxylic acid with a mono- and/or dialkylamine (A) and ii) 5-100% by weight, based on the amount of amide-ammonium salt (A), of an oil-soluble amine (B), and iii) 0.1 to 10 parts by weight, based on the amount of amide-ammonium salt (A), of a resin formed from at least one aromatic compound bearing an alkyl radical and an aldehyde and/or ketone (D).

The invention claimed is: 1. A method of improving the low-temperature properties of a fuel oil having a sulfur content of less than 50 ppm, and comprising a lubricity additive (C), wherein the method comprises the step of adding a low-temperature additive to the fuel oil, the low-temperature additive comprising i) at least one oil-soluble amide-ammonium salt of a polycarboxylic acid with a mono- and/or dialkylamine (A), ii) 5-100% by weight, based on the amount of amide-ammonium salt (A), of an oil-soluble amine (B), and iii) 0.1 to 10 parts by weight, based on the amount of amide-ammonium salt (A), of a resin formed from at least one aromatic compound bearing an alkyl radical and an aldehyde and/or ketone (D), wherein the fuel oil contains between 50 and 1000 ppm of a lubricity additive (C) selected from the group consisting of fatty acids, oligomers of unsaturated fatty acids, alk(en)ylsuccinic acids, partial esters of polyols with fatty acids, oligomers of unsaturated fatty acids, alk(en)ylsuccinic acids, fatty acid amides of alkanolamines and mixtures thereof. 2.
